#include <time.h>
#include "sem.h"
#include "../ims_usrloc_pcscf/usrloc.h"
#include "../ims_dialog/dlg_load.h"
#include "../cdp/session.h"
#include "mod.h"
#include "cdpeventprocessor.h"
#include "rx_str.h"
#include "ims_qos_stats.h"
cdp_cb_event_list_t *cdp_event_list = 0;
extern usrloc_api_t ul;
extern struct dlg_binds dlgb;
extern int cdp_event_latency;
extern int cdp_event_threshold;
extern int cdp_event_latency_loglevel;
extern int cdp_event_list_size_threshold;
extern struct ims_qos_counters_h ims_qos_cnts_h;
extern int terminate_dialog_on_rx_failure;
int init_cdp_cb_event_list() {
cdp_event_list = shm_malloc(sizeof (cdp_cb_event_list_t));
if (!cdp_event_list) {
LM_ERR("No more SHM mem\n");
return 0;
}
memset(cdp_event_list, 0, sizeof (cdp_cb_event_list_t));
cdp_event_list->lock = lock_alloc();
if (!cdp_event_list->lock) {
LM_ERR("failed to create cdp event list lock\n");
return 0;
}
cdp_event_list->lock = lock_init(cdp_event_list->lock);
cdp_event_list->size = 0;
sem_new(cdp_event_list->empty, 0); //pre-locked - as we assume list is empty at start
return 1;
}
void destroy_cdp_cb_event_list() {
cdp_cb_event_t *ev, *tmp;
lock_get(cdp_event_list->lock);
ev = cdp_event_list->head;
while (ev) {
tmp = ev->next;
free_cdp_cb_event(ev);
ev = tmp;
}
lock_destroy(cdp_event_list->lock);
lock_dealloc(cdp_event_list->lock);
shm_free(cdp_event_list);
}
cdp_cb_event_t* new_cdp_cb_event(int event, str *rx_session_id, rx_authsessiondata_t *session_data) {
cdp_cb_event_t *new_event = shm_malloc(sizeof (cdp_cb_event_t));
if (!new_event) {
LM_ERR("no more shm mem\n");
return NULL;
}
memset(new_event, 0, sizeof (cdp_cb_event_t));
//we have to make a copy of the rx session id because it is not in shm mem
if ((rx_session_id->len > 0) && rx_session_id->s) {
LM_DBG("Creating new event for rx session [%.*s]\n", rx_session_id->len, rx_session_id->s);
new_event->rx_session_id.s = (char*) shm_malloc(rx_session_id->len);
if (!new_event->rx_session_id.s) {
LM_ERR("no more shm memory\n");
shm_free(new_event);
return NULL;
}
memcpy(new_event->rx_session_id.s, rx_session_id->s, rx_session_id->len);
new_event->rx_session_id.len = rx_session_id->len;
}
new_event->event = event;
new_event->registered = time(NULL);
new_event->session_data = session_data; //session_data is already in shm mem
return new_event;
}
//add to tail
void push_cdp_cb_event(cdp_cb_event_t* event) {
lock_get(cdp_event_list->lock);
if (cdp_event_list->head == 0) { //empty list
cdp_event_list->head = cdp_event_list->tail = event;
} else {
cdp_event_list->tail->next = event;
cdp_event_list->tail = event;
}
cdp_event_list->size++;
if(cdp_event_list_size_threshold > 0 && cdp_event_list->size > cdp_event_list_size_threshold) {
LM_WARN("cdp_event_list is size [%d] and has exceed cdp_event_list_size_threshold of [%d]", cdp_event_list->size, cdp_event_list_size_threshold);
}
sem_release(cdp_event_list->empty);
lock_release(cdp_event_list->lock);
}
//pop from head
cdp_cb_event_t* pop_cdp_cb_event() {
cdp_cb_event_t *ev;
lock_get(cdp_event_list->lock);
while (cdp_event_list->head == 0) {
lock_release(cdp_event_list->lock);
sem_get(cdp_event_list->empty);
lock_get(cdp_event_list->lock);
}
ev = cdp_event_list->head;
cdp_event_list->head = ev->next;
if (ev == cdp_event_list->tail) { //list now empty
cdp_event_list->tail = 0;
}
ev->next = 0; //make sure whoever gets this cant access our list
cdp_event_list->size--;
lock_release(cdp_event_list->lock);
return ev;
}
/*main event process function*/
void cdp_cb_event_process() {
cdp_cb_event_t *ev;
udomain_t* domain;
pcontact_t* pcontact;
pcontact_info_t contact_info;
struct pcontact_info ci;
memset(&ci, 0, sizeof (struct pcontact_info));
for (;;) {
ev = pop_cdp_cb_event();
if (cdp_event_latency) { //track delays
unsigned int diff = time(NULL) - ev->registered;
if (diff > cdp_event_threshold) {
switch (cdp_event_latency_loglevel) {
case 0:
LM_ERR("Took to long to pickup CDP callback event [%d] > [%d]\n", diff, cdp_event_threshold);
break;
case 1:
LM_WARN("Took to long to pickup CDP callback event [%d] > [%d]\n", diff, cdp_event_threshold);
break;
case 2:
LM_INFO("Took to long to pickup CDP callback event [%d] > [%d]\n", diff, cdp_event_threshold);
break;
case 3:
LM_DBG("Took to long to pickup CDP callback event [%d] > [%d]\n", diff, cdp_event_threshold);
break;
default:
LM_DBG("Unknown log level....printing as debug\n");
LM_DBG("Took to long to pickup CDP callback event [%d] > [%d]\n", diff, cdp_event_threshold);
break;
}
}
}
LM_DBG("processing event [%d]\n", ev->event);
rx_authsessiondata_t *p_session_data = ev->session_data;
str *rx_session_id = &ev->rx_session_id;
switch (ev->event) {
case AUTH_EV_SESSION_TIMEOUT:
case AUTH_EV_SESSION_GRACE_TIMEOUT:
case AUTH_EV_RECV_ASR:
LM_DBG("Received notification of ASR from transport plane or CDP timeout for CDP session with Rx session ID: [%.*s] and associated contact [%.*s]"
" and domain [%.*s]\n",
rx_session_id->len, rx_session_id->s,
p_session_data->registration_aor.len, p_session_data->registration_aor.s,
p_session_data->domain.len, p_session_data->domain.s);
if (p_session_data->subscribed_to_signaling_path_status) {
LM_DBG("This is a subscription to signalling bearer session");
//nothing to do here - just wait for AUTH_EV_SERVICE_TERMINATED event
} else {
LM_DBG("This is a media bearer session session");
//this is a media bearer session that was terminated from the transport plane - we need to terminate the associated dialog
//so we set p_session_data->must_terminate_dialog to 1 and when we receive AUTH_EV_SERVICE_TERMINATED event we will terminate the dialog
//we only terminate the dialog if terminate_dialog_on_rx_failure is set
if(terminate_dialog_on_rx_failure) {
p_session_data->must_terminate_dialog = 1;
}
}
break;
case AUTH_EV_SERVICE_TERMINATED:
LM_DBG("Received notification of CDP TERMINATE of CDP session with Rx session ID: [%.*s] and associated contact [%.*s]"
" and domain [%.*s]\n",
rx_session_id->len, rx_session_id->s,
p_session_data->registration_aor.len, p_session_data->registration_aor.s,
p_session_data->domain.len, p_session_data->domain.s);
if (p_session_data->subscribed_to_signaling_path_status) {
LM_DBG("This is a subscription to signalling bearer session");
//instead of removing the contact from usrloc_pcscf we just change the state of the contact to TERMINATE_PENDING_NOTIFY
//pcscf_registrar sees this, sends a SIP PUBLISH and on SIP NOTIFY the contact is deleted
//note we only send SIP PUBLISH if the session has been successfully opened
if(p_session_data->session_has_been_opened) {
if (ul.register_udomain(p_session_data->domain.s, &domain)
< 0) {
LM_DBG("Unable to register usrloc domain....aborting\n");
return;
}
ul.lock_udomain(domain, &p_session_data->via_host, p_session_data->via_port, p_session_data->via_proto);
contact_info.received_host = p_session_data->ip;
contact_info.received_port = p_session_data->recv_port;
contact_info.received_proto = p_session_data->recv_proto;
contact_info.searchflag = (1 << SEARCH_RECEIVED);
contact_info.via_host = p_session_data->via_host;
contact_info.via_port = p_session_data->via_port;
contact_info.via_prot = p_session_data->via_proto;
contact_info.aor = p_session_data->registration_aor;
contact_info.reg_state = PCONTACT_ANY;
if (ul.get_pcontact(domain, &contact_info, &pcontact) != 0) {
LM_DBG("no contact found for terminated Rx reg session..... ignoring\n");
} else {
LM_DBG("Updating contact [%.*s] after Rx reg session terminated, setting state to PCONTACT_DEREG_PENDING_PUBLISH\n", pcontact->aor.len, pcontact->aor.s);
ci.reg_state = PCONTACT_DEREG_PENDING_PUBLISH;
ci.num_service_routes = 0;
ul.update_pcontact(domain, &ci, pcontact);
}
ul.unlock_udomain(domain, &p_session_data->via_host, p_session_data->via_port, p_session_data->via_proto);
counter_add(ims_qos_cnts_h.active_registration_rx_sessions, -1);
}
} else {
LM_DBG("This is a media bearer session session");
if(p_session_data->session_has_been_opened) {
LM_DBG("Session was opened so decrementing active_media_rx_sessions\n");
counter_add(ims_qos_cnts_h.active_media_rx_sessions, -1);
}
//we only terminate the dialog if this was triggered from the transport plane or timeout - i.e. if must_terminate_dialog is set
//if this was triggered from the signalling plane (i.e. someone hanging up) then we don'y need to terminate the dialog
if (p_session_data->must_terminate_dialog) {
LM_DBG("Terminating dialog with callid, ftag, ttag: [%.*s], [%.*s], [%.*s]\n",
p_session_data->callid.len, p_session_data->callid.s,
p_session_data->ftag.len, p_session_data->ftag.s,
p_session_data->ttag.len, p_session_data->ttag.s);
dlgb.terminate_dlg(&p_session_data->callid,
&p_session_data->ftag, &p_session_data->ttag, &confirmed_qosrelease_headers,
&early_qosrelease_reason);
}
}
//free callback data
if (p_session_data) {
free_callsessiondata(p_session_data);
}
break;
default:
break;
}
free_cdp_cb_event(ev);
}
}
void free_cdp_cb_event(cdp_cb_event_t *ev) {
if (ev) {
LM_DBG("Freeing cdpb CB event structure\n");
if (ev->rx_session_id.len > 0 && ev->rx_session_id.s) {
LM_DBG("about to free string from cdp CB event [%.*s]\n", ev->rx_session_id.len, ev->rx_session_id.s);
shm_free(ev->rx_session_id.s);
}
shm_free(ev);
}
}
